Spam
I've never been a big fan of Spam, but a while back I saw some on sale and figured it would be a good emergency food so I bought some.
Yesterday I made a breakfast casserole with one of the cans I had bought. I did not have high hopes, but it turned out to be not bad.
Storing food is a good idea, but knowing how to make the stored food palatable is also good.
Preheat oven to 350
6 potatoes, around 3"x6" each
8 eggs
6 slices American cheese
1 medium onion
2 green sweet peppers
1 large jalapeño, preferably left on the plant until it turns red
1 can Spam
Peel potatoes and cut into 1" cubes. Boil until a fork easily goes into the cubes
Drain and put into a casserole dish.
Chop onions, peppers, jalapeño. Cut Spam into 1/2" cubes. Fry onions, peppers and Spam in a little butter or margarine until veggies are tender. Add eggs and stir mixture until eggs are just cooked but not dry. Put mixture in casserole dish dish and gently mix in with the potato cubes. Put the cheese on top and bake for around 20 minutes.
